Output 865327abc2d65a5fec4ea85550428c06ec0215521d6a356d1908bcf4e11339fe:0

value
2710015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ca6927957c2a754277acb603feabb7586175a7 OP_EQUALVERIFY OP_CHECKSIG
address
13G5hMJkyRpubR5z9zt7qDvf2JEuVv9iGg
transaction
865327abc2d65a5fec4ea85550428c06ec0215521d6a356d1908bcf4e11339fe
confirmations
305426
spent
true